66923103025 has 27 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 85799331873. Its totient is φ = 51780391200.
The previous prime is 66923103017. The next prime is 66923103031. The reversal of 66923103025 is 52030132966.
The square root of 66923103025 is 258695.
It is a perfect power (a square), and thus also a powerful number.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in 4 ways, for example, as 783608049 + 66139494976 = 27993^2 + 257176^2 .
It is not a de Polignac number, because 66923103025 - 23 = 66923103017 is a prime.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(19)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 26 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 40096891 + ... + 40098559.
Almost surely, 266923103025 is an apocalyptic number.
66923103025 is the 258695-th square number.
66923103025 is the 129348-th centered octagonal number.
It is an amenable number.
66923103025 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(18876228848).
66923103025 is an frugal number, since it uses more digits than its factorization.
66923103025 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 3410 (or 1705 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 58320, while the sum is 37.
